DEAEPP - Curricular Structure

img template

The Doctoral Program in Engineering and Public Policy (DEAEPP) consists of a doctoral curricular component and the preparation of an original research thesis.

The overall structure corresponds to 240 ECTS, with a standard duration of 4 years / 8 semesters, organized as follows:

ComponentCredits
Doctoral Course (curricular component)30 ECTS
Doctoral Thesis in Engineering and Public Policy210 ECTS
Total240 ECTS

The predominant scientific area of the cycle of studies is Engineering and Management.

Organization

The program is organized into two main components:

  1. Curricular component, corresponding to the Doctoral Course, with 30 ECTS
  2. Research component, corresponding to the curricular unit Doctoral Thesis in Engineering and Public Policy, with 210 ECTS

The curricular component allows the student to consolidate advanced training at the interface between engineering, technology, and public policy, select curricular units aligned with their scientific path, and complete cross-cutting training relevant to the development of the doctorate.

The research component leads to the definition, development, writing, and public defense of an original thesis.

Operating Regime

The DEAEPP was developed in partnership with the Department of Engineering and Public Policy at Carnegie Mellon University (Pittsburgh, USA) and is part of the CMU-Portugal program.

The program operates in two formats:

  1. IST/CMU Dual Degree — in partnership with Carnegie Mellon University, where students spend part of their path at CMU to obtain the double degree;
  2. Track entirely at IST — a program entirely taught at Instituto Superior Técnico.

In the case of the dual degree, candidates must be admitted by both institutions and typically present recent results from the GRE and TOEFL exams, applying directly to the EPP program at CMU. The final classification of candidates for the dual program is determined by a Joint Selection Committee.

Curricular Component

The curricular component corresponds to the Doctoral Course, with 30 ECTS.

According to the study plan published in Order No. 6462/2021, the 30 ECTS are distributed across three scientific areas:

Scientific AreaAcronymCredits
Organization Engineering and ManagementEGO12 ECTS
Systems Engineering and ManagementEGS6 ECTS
Options — All scientific areas of ISTOL12 ECTS
Total30 ECTS

The curricular component is concentrated in the 1st year of the cycle of studies. The research component (Thesis) runs throughout the four years.

Study Plan

Curricular UnitScientific AreaYear / SemesterCredits
Public Policies Theory, Practice and AnalysisEGO1st year, 1st semester6 ECTS
Free OptionOL1st year, 1st semester6 ECTS
Models and Applications in Decision AnalysisEGS1st year, 2nd semester6 ECTS
Quantitative Research MethodsEGO1st year, 2nd semester6 ECTS
Free OptionOL1st year, 1st or 2nd semester6 ECTS
ThesisACEG1st year (annual)30 ECTS
ThesisACEG2nd year (annual)60 ECTS
ThesisACEG3rd year (annual)60 ECTS
ThesisACEG4th year (annual)60 ECTS

Mandatory Curricular Units

The curricular component includes the following mandatory curricular units:

  • Public Policies Theory, Practice and Analysis (EGO, 6 ECTS) — introduction to decision-making in the context of public policy, market failures and public intervention, paradigms and conceptual frameworks for policy analysis, and engineering and management approaches to public decision-making
  • Quantitative Research Methods (EGO, 6 ECTS) — training in quantitative methods to support research
  • Models and Applications in Decision Analysis (EGS, 6 ECTS) — models and methods for decision analysis and their applications

Free Options Block

The Free Options Block corresponds to 12 ECTS, completed through two optional curricular units of 6 ECTS each.

Free options can be chosen from all scientific areas of IST, allowing the student to complete training aligned with their scientific path and thesis topic. The list of optional curricular units is established annually by the legally and statutorily competent bodies of IST.

The selection of curricular units must be made in coordination with the program coordination and the student's scientific path.

Thesis Monitoring Committee (CAT)

The Thesis Monitoring Committee (CAT) monitors the scientific development of the doctorate, in conjunction with the student, the scientific supervision, and the program coordination.

The role of CAT is to support the regular monitoring of the research plan, evaluate the progress of the work, and identify any potential needs for scientific, methodological, or institutional adjustment.

Formation and Deadline (Article 14)

According to the General Doctoral Regulations, the formation of the CAT follows these main rules:

  • Deadline: The formation of the CAT must be proposed to the coordinator of the doctoral program within 12 months from the official enrollment date (Article 14, paragraph 2).
  • Composition:
    • The committee must have a maximum of six members (extra members are allowed only on an exceptional basis and with proper justification).
    • It is constituted by the scientific supervision team and a minimum of two professors, researchers, or experts of recognized merit eligible for the jury (provided the supervisory members do not exceed the number of the remaining members).
  • Presidency: It is held by the most senior IST member in the highest category, excluding the members of the supervision team.

The composition, operation, and formal moments of monitoring must be confirmed in the regulations applicable to Técnico's doctoral programs and the specific rules of the program.

Progress in Research Activities

Progress in research activities corresponds to the continuous development of the scientific work leading to the thesis, at the interface between engineering, technology, and public policy.

This phase generally includes:

  • definition and consolidation of the research topic
  • critical literature review
  • formulation of research questions
  • methodological development
  • collection, processing, or production of data, when applicable
  • development of models, methods, analyses, or empirical studies to support decision-making and public policy design
  • production of scientific results
  • presentation and discussion of results in seminars, conferences, or other scientific contexts
  • preparation of scientific publications, when applicable

The monitoring of progress should be done in conjunction with the scientific supervision, the CAT, and the program coordination.

Writing the Thesis

Writing the thesis corresponds to the systematization of the research work developed during the doctorate.

The thesis must present an original scientific contribution in the area of Engineering and Public Policy — typically in the design, analysis, and evaluation of public policies in domains where technology is a determining factor — and demonstrate the capacity for autonomous research, methodological mastery, and a critical framing of the studied problem.

The specific structure of the thesis should be defined with the scientific supervision and in accordance with the applicable Técnico standards. In the case of students in the IST/CMU dual degree regime, the rules applicable at Carnegie Mellon University must also be observed.

Thesis Defense

The thesis defense corresponds to the public act of appraisal and discussion of the research work developed.

The submission, appraisal, formation of the jury, scheduling of the public exam, and other procedures must follow the regulations applicable to Técnico doctorates and the rules of the Postgraduate Area. In the case of students in the IST/CMU dual degree regime, the procedures established under the partnership with Carnegie Mellon University also apply.
